PayPal, Inc. seeks Machine Learning Engineer in San Jose, CA
Job Duties: Design, develop, implement, deploy, and monitor predictive models using machine learning techniques, including neural networks and tree-based models. Work with large volumes of data, including extracting insights and manipulating big data covering a wide range of information. Collaborate with other ML scientists and engineers to formulate innovative solutions, experiment, and implement advanced ML techniques to solve business problems. Clearly and effectively communicate complex concepts, analysis insights, and modeling results through creative visualization to stakeholders of varying technical levels. Build credit models to predict delinquency, fraud and repayment behavior for merchant loans, conduct experiments to improve model performance and facilitate model deployment. Ensure credit models solve business problems, ensure models' compliance to regulation, enhance internal risk controls and improve operational efficiency to enable the best user experience. Partial telecommuting permitted from a commutable distance.
Minimum Requirements: Master's degree, or foreign equivalent, in Mathematics, Statistics, or a closely related field in the job offered or a related occupation.
Special Skill Requirements:
1. Develop and deploy machine learning models using Python, including NumPy and PyTorch frameworks.
2. Write and optimize SQL queries in Google BigQuery or HiveQL for high-volume data extraction, transformation, and feature engineering.
3. Implement deep learning architectures such as convolutional neural networks (CNNs), recurrent neural networks (RNNs), and Transformers.
4. Apply natural language processing (NLP) techniques for text analytics and language understanding.
5. Conduct experimental design for model building and selection methods.
6. Perform statistical analysis including regression modeling and hypothesis testing.
7. Create analytical visualizations in Python and/or Excel to communicate data insights.
8. Programming on Unix command line and Bash scripting.
9. Use Git for source-code management.
10. Experience in Jupyter Notebooks and/or Google Colab for interactive analysis and modeling.
